Latin-English dictionary »

scutra meaning in English

LatinEnglish
scutra [scutrae] (1st) F
noun

shallow / flat dish / pan / tray / platternoun

shovel (Vulgate)noun
[UK: ˈʃʌv.l̩] [US: ˈʃʌv.l̩]

square [squares]noun
[UK: skweə(r)] [US: ˈskwer]